Content descriptions
General Note: | Bonus features: Read along option available. |
Formatted Contents Note: | Harold and the purple crayon / by Crockett Johnson -- A picture for Harold's room / by Crockett Johnson -- Harold's fairy tale / by Crockett Johnson -- Mysterious tadpole / by Steven Kellogg -- Drummer Hoff / by Barbara Emberley, illustrated by Ed Emberley -- Smile for Auntie / by Diane Paterson. |
Creation/Production Credits Note: | Animators, Bohumil Šejda, Michael Sporn, Bridget Thorne, Bohuslav Šrámek, Milan Klikar ; editors, Paul Gagne, Zdenka Narrátilová ; music, Jimmy Carroll, Karel Velebný, Ernest Troost. |
Participant or Performer Note: | Narrators, Norman Rose, Neil Innes. |
Summary, etc.: | Harold wants to take a walk in the moonlight, so he draws a moon with his purple crayon. Next Harold wants a picture for his room, soon he's bigger than a mountain. Then with his crayon, Harold takes a trip through the enchanted garden where he meets a King, a giant witch, and a fairy with one magic wish. |
Target Audience Note: | "Recommended for ages 2-6"--Container. |
